Common Injuries Sustained in Front-End Car Accidents

According to the Illinois Crash Facts and Statistics document provided by The Illinois Department of Transportation, there were a total of 2,568 head-on car crashes recorded in one year, with 103 of them resulting in a fatality. While all auto accident victims are at risk for every kind of injury, head-on collisions may result in some particularly severe injuries that are not seen in other types of auto accidents.

The first points of impact in a front-end collision are the knees and feet, which may be subjected to anything from a stress fracture to a ligament tear. When the knees hit the steering wheel or dashboard, even the slightest impact can result in years of discomfort. A serious crash can result in extensive surgery and possible amputation of the leg.

The spinal cord is another susceptible area that becomes vulnerable in front-end collisions. The force of a crash can travel up the back and cause injury in the form of a herniated disk or even paralysis.

Factors that May Affect the Value of a Settlement

Special damages can play a pivotal role in the amount of compensation an accident victim can receive from a head-on collision lawsuit. These damages are meant to make up for economic losses related to an accident, including but not limited to:

  • Lost wages
  • Medical expenses
  • Property damage
  • Funeral and burial expenses
  • Lost earning capacity

Additionally, a qualified Wheaton front-end car accident lawyer could help potential plaintiffs seek recovery for general damages as well, which refer to non-economic losses such as pain and suffering or loss of enjoyment of life. The more permanent and severe either kind of damages are, the higher the final settlement amount may be.
